Free Math Help offered Online by the Ministry of Education in Ontario


In Ontario, students of grades 7 to 10 can now get free math help after school online and for free. Homework Help is an online portal by the Ontario Ministry of Education launched already two years ago in the Near North District and it will now be available for the entire province.

Students use their Ontario Student Education Number to register on the platform and then get access to math teachers employed by the Ministry. They engage via chat and interactive whiteboard and the students can also choose if they prefer to stay anonymous during the session.

The live interaction with teachers is available from Sunday through Thursday between 5:30pm to 9:30pm. Besides the live interaction with a teacher the Homework Help platform also offers other online resources like video tutorials, FAQ, interactive games and a virtual locker to save their work.
